About the Opportunity

DMI, LLC is seeking a Power BI Developer / BI Engineer to play a key role in designing, developing, and maintaining scalable Business Intelligence (BI) solutions for enterprise clients. The individual will lead initiatives around Power BI development, data modelling, and infrastructure management across multiple business domains. This position requires strong technical expertise in Power BI, SQL, and Data Management, along with the ability to work with Microsoft Fabric infrastructure (Warehouse and Lakehouse).

Duties

and Responsibilities
  • BI Design & Development:
    • Design and develop interactive Power BI dashboards and reports with optimized DAX and data modeling.
    • Develop and maintain data flows using Power Query, ensuring efficiency and consistency across reports.
    • Implement and manage ETL pipelines to integrate data from diverse sources into the BI ecosystem.
    • Leverage Microsoft Fabric infrastructure, including Warehouse and Lakehouse, for scalable and secure data management.
    • Ensure high data quality, consistency, and integrity across reporting layers.
  • Data Architecture & Management:
    • Define and maintain data architecture standards and governance frameworks.
    • Work with Data Engineering teams to design efficient data models supporting analytics and reporting needs.
    • Monitor and optimize BI performance, troubleshoot issues, and ensure system stability.
    • Maintain and enhance existing BI infrastructure in alignment with organizational and client needs.
  • Stakeholder Engagement & Leadership:
    • Collaborate with business users, project managers, and cross‑functional teams to gather reporting requirements and deliver BI solutions.
    • Communicate effectively with both technical and non‑technical stakeholders.
    • Lead discussions around data‑driven decision‑making and solution design.
    • Mentor and guide junior BI developers on technical skills, coding standards, and best practices.
  • Innovation & Continuous Improvement:
    • Stay current with emerging BI technologies and tools, especially within the Microsoft ecosystem.
    • Recommend improvements to processes, tools, and data architectures to enhance BI efficiency and scalability.
    • Participate in proof‑of‑concept (POC) initiatives for advanced analytics and automation opportunities.
Qualifications Required Skills & Experience
  • 5-8 years of experience in Business Intelligence development, with a focus on Power BI.
  • Strong expertise in Power Query, DAX, and advanced data modelling techniques.
  • Proficiency in SQL for querying, optimization, and ETL logic development.
  • Hands‑on experience in Data Management and 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) processes.
  • Experience working with Microsoft Fabric, including Warehouse and Lakehouse concepts.
  • Strong analytical mindset with the ability to interpret complex data and provide actionable insights.
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ills for stakeholder engagement and business discussions.
Good to Have (Preferred Skills)
  • Experience with PySpark or Python for data transformation and automation.
  • Exposure to Cognos BI or other enterprise BI platforms.
  • Experience with Power Apps and Microsoft ecosystem integration.
  • Familiarity with Azure Data Services (e.g., Data Factory, Synapse, Databricks).
Qualifications (Education)
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Data Analytics, or related field.
  • Microsoft certifications in Power BI, Fabric, or SQL Server preferred.
